Rick and Morty, maybe an important animated collection on television right now, had been surprisingly proof against mainstream memes until September when “20 Minutes Adventure” broke by way of. Rick promised his grandson Morty a 20-minute adventure via a portal, nevertheless it turned into a six-day nightmare. The screengrab of that second is now a meme that represents any quagmire that took longer and turned out worse than expected.

A Milkshake Duck is a well-liked internet character who inevitably ends up disappointing their audience by expressing unpopular or offensive views.
